Saint Louis uses 17-0 run to defeat Butler 64-52

ST. LOUIS -- Javon Bess scored 18 points, and Hasahn French added nine points and eight rebounds and Saint Louis defeated Butler 64-52 Saturday.

The Billikens (6-1) broke the game open with a 17-0 run that commenced when Bess hit a 3-pointer with 5:37 remaining for his first points of the game.

Saint Louis held the Bulldogs (5-2) without a point for a span of 8:11 after Sean McDermott hit a 3-pointer with 5:55 remaining in the first half.

McDermott led Butler with 12 points on four 3-point baskets, all coming in the first half, and Aaron Thompson added 11.
